    Installed the later model ECU just before....

    Plugged it in.... connected the battery up......turn the key to on.....no problem there.....turned the key.....VROOOOM!

    It works

    Drove it around for about an hour, no problems.

    Throttle response is better and u can fell that extra 20bhp there too, my head gets pushed back a lot harder than before

    Now me thinks that the ECU from the manual VR4 is the same as the later models auto ECU INSERT INTO post VALUES ( i plugged the later model autos ECU into the manuals wiring loom to see if they would connect up which they did); they just started to put them into the autos at a later date. So if any of u guys could get together to do a test for me and get 2 cars that are of the same year or as close as, one manual and one auto and plug the manuals ECU into the auto. They must be the early models as well before the face lift.... duh
